Villa Storingavika in Norway, a Stunning View

Located on the West Coast of the Bergen archipelago in Norway, Villa Storingavika is one of the most strikingly beautiful structure clad in glass, black stained wood and oiled natural wood. The rocky hillside, the green garden and the wonderful view of blue waters makes that home a complete delight. Constructed with an attempt to utilize the available space to a maximum by Saunders Architecture, the two floors of the building are styled to face the rough Norwegian weather. The interiors are shaped to match the exterior design and the shower with a glass view is one feature that you will not really find far too often anywhere else in the world!
